Is it guarantee to an opportunity or guarantee of an opportunity?

The correct phrase is "guarantee of an opportunity." This phrase indicates that there is a promise or assurance regarding the availability of a specific chance or possibility. In contrast, "guarantee to an opportunity" is not commonly used and may sound awkward.
